In 2012 Studio One Eleven completed the first parklets, also known as street decks, in Southern California. Click here to view the full Parklet Study presented by Studio One Eleven.

These decks typically replace curbside parking fronting a shop in order to provide outdoor dining for restaurants wanting to expand. Since then, Studio One Eleven has completed numerous installations throughout Los Angeles and San Diego counties. The firm has recently completed three parklets in downtown Long Beach that reflect the evolution and expansion of their use.

Two other parklets, one located on Pine Avenue and the other on Fourth Street are designed as contemporary seating courts to support multiple restaurants. Permitted, financed and constructed by the landlord of “the Streets” development, the parklets provide convenient outdoor dining. The landlord is compensated for the investment by charging each tenant additional rent.

Parklets are taking on other uses other than for public seating or outdoor dining. The street deck for Groundwork Fitness is the first training parklet in the country. Workout routines are performed with various equipment within the interiors of the gym and the parklet now serves as an outdoor fitness station. Located on the street, this training station animates the sidewalk and encourages people to live a healthy lifestyle.
